Abdur rashid

Abdul Rashid (Arabic: عبد الرشيد‎‎) is a male Muslim given name, and in modern usage, surname. It is built from the Arabic words Abd, al- and Rashid. The name means "servant of the right-minded", Ar-Rashīd being one of the names of God in the Qur'an, which give rise to the Muslim theophoric names.

Meaning: Slave of the Guide Origin: Arabic

Abdur rauf

Abdur Rauf (Arabic: عبد الرؤوف ‎‎) is a male Muslim given name. ... The name means "servant of the Lenient One", Ar-Ra'ūf being one of the names of God in the Qur'an, which give rise to the Muslim theophoric names. The letter a of the al- is unstressed, and can be transliterated by almost any vowel, often by u.

Abdur razzaq

Abdul Razzaq (Arabic: عبد الرزاق ‎‎) is a male Muslim given name, and in modern usage, surname. It is built from the Arabic words Abd, al- and Razzaq. The name means "servant of the all-provider", Ar-Razzāq being one of the names of God in the Qur'an, which give rise to the Muslim theophoric names.

Abdus sabur

Abdus Sabur (Arabic: عبد الصبور ‎‎) is a male Muslim given name, built on the Arabic words Abd, al- and Sabur. The name means "servant of the Patient One", As-Sabur being one of the names of God in the Qur'an, which give rise to the Muslim theophoric names.

Meaning: Slave of the Forbearing Origin: Arabic

Abdus samad

Abdul Samad (Arabic: عبد الصمد‎‎) is a male Muslim given name, built on the Arabic words Abd, al- and Samad. The name means "servant of the Everlasting", al-Samad being one of the names of God in the Qur'an, which give rise to the Muslim theophoric names.

Meaning: Servant of the Eternal Origin: Arabic
